What is Trinity International University?
Trinity International University, a liberal arts college with a campus in Deerfield, Illinois, and Regional Centers in Florida, Chicago, and California, offers a wide range of undergraduate majors, including nontraditional options. Trinity Graduate School offers several programs available in Florida, California, and Deerfield, Illinois. Trinity Evangelical Divinity School, one of the largest seminaries in the world, enrolls more than 1,200 graduate students in professional and academic programs, including more than 100 in its PhD programs. At the heart of the divinity school lies the Master of Divinity degree. TEDS also offers a range of more focused programs: the Master of Arts academic program and Master of Arts professional programs. The school offers the ThM and DMin as well. Trinity Law School offers the Juris Doctor degree. Graduates may sit for the Bar examination of the State Bar of California.
